Sloefmans (15389) reviewed Cidre de Glace from Domaine Pinnacle 20 years ago
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 8 | Flavor - 7 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 8
2002 Bottling Very clear gold colour, honeyish. Intense sweet apples nose, with a touch of fresh wild dark mushrooms. Very sweet, liqueurish taste, but retronasal typical malonic acid, as green apples. Good, and very balanced IMO, despite the syrupy sweetness. Oily, syrupy MF, light acidic burning touch. Alcohol obvious but not imposing. Very good, IMO, ideal dessert wine. Big thanks to Mike & Bo from me and Lut.
Ungstrup (52110) reviewed Cidre de Glace from Domaine Pinnacle 21 years ago
Appearance - 6 | Aroma - 7 | Flavor - 7 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 8
[vintage 2002] The aroma is of apples, gorgonzola cheese, and wood. The color is orange with no head. The flavor is very sweet with notes of apples and wood. The mouthfeel is like sirup and the alcohol burns the throat. A fantastic cider. Thanks Jacob, for sharing.
